Events from the year 1754 in the Kingdom of Great Britain.

Incumbents

*Monarch - George II of the United Kingdom
*Prime Minister - Henry Pelham, Whig (to 6 March), Thomas Pelham-Holles, 1st Duke of Newcastle-upon-Tyne, Whig

Events

* 28 January - Horace Walpole, in a letter to Horace Mann, coins the word "serendipity".
* 6 March - Thomas Pelham-Holles, 1st Duke of Newcastle-upon-Tyne becomes Prime Minister following the death of his brother Henry Pelham.cite book|last=Williams|first=Hywel|title=Cassell's Chronology of World History|publisher=Weidenfeld & Nicolson|year=2005|isbn=0-304-35730-8|pages=317]
* May - General election increases the Whig Party's majority.cite book |last=Palmer |first=Alan & Veronica |year=1992 |title= The Chronology of British History|publisher= Century Ltd|location=London|pages= 220-221|isbn= 0-7126-5616-2]

Undated

* The The Royal and Ancient Golf Club of St Andrews is founded in Scotland, and formally writes down the rules of golf for the first time.

Publications

* David Hume's "The History of Great Britain".
* Thomas Chippendale's "The Gentleman and Cabinet Maker's Director". [cite web|url=http://www.icons.org.uk/theicons/icons-timeline/1750-1800|title=Icons, a portrait of England 1750-1800|accessdate=2007-08-24]
* Posthumous publication of Isaac Newton's dissertation "An Historical Account of Two Notable Corruptions of Scripture".

Births

* 11 July - Thomas Bowdler, physician (died 1825)
* 21 August - William Murdoch, inventor (died 1839)
* 9 September - William Bligh, sailor (died 1817)
* 24 December - George Crabbe, poet (died 1832)

Deaths

* 10 January - Edward Cave, editor and publisher (born 1691)
* 16 February - Richard Mead, physician (born 1673)
* 6 March - Henry Pelham, Prime Minister (born 1696)
* 2 April - Thomas Carte, historian (born 1686)
* 23 May - John Wood, the Elder, architect (born 1704)
* 2 June - Ebenezer Erskine, religious dissenter (born 1680)
* 8 October - Henry Fielding, novelist (born 1707)
